Position Summary The Team Lead, Welding and Fabrication TFR (Taco Fall River) coordinates employees on both high volume and custom tank production lines and schedules and assigns work as required. They train new hires throughout the departments and coordinate all programming and modifications for robotic welding cells. They schedule people, machinery, and sub assembly cells to ensure continuous throughput and high labor efficiencies and prioritize special parts, instructing operators on how to build them. The Team Lead, Welding and Fabrication updates the supervisor on output from the production lines and reviews data in daily production meetings, as well as interacts with buying/planning staff to minimize disruptions. They are subject matter experts on complex welding and fabrication and also provide backup for the supervisor as needed.

Responsibilities Responsibilities include but are not limited to:
Ensures welders are performing welding techniques properly and within ASME guidelines
Troubleshoots complex welding and fabrication and provides guidance to employees for those tasks
Prioritizes schedules to ensure maximum output
Uses various types of welding equipment and a variety of common hand and power tools
Guides employees in performing fit up and welding on most complex tanks
Programs welding robots, developing programs and methodologies for program structure
Troubleshoots welding program issues as needed and interacts directly with robot manufacturers to solve complex mechanical and program problems
Coordinates subassembly cells to produce volume needed to minimize work interruptions
Reviews schedules with supervisor and production staff
Provides manufacturing engineering with critical dimension data for specialty products
Reviews Epicor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) jobs for completion
Coaches employees on standard and complex welding techniques and how to utilize the ERP system
Coordinates with other shifts to ensure proper material flow
Assigns and directs work based on needs of the shift
Provides advanced instruction and training to welding and fabrication employees
Provides feedback to management on an individual’s progress, abilities and aptitude
Serves as a subject matter expert within fabrication, resolving complex issues with weldments and fabrication techniques
Ensures their own safety and that of team members
Maintains work area in a neat and organized manner to 5S standards
Coordinates all first shift manufacturing activities in the tank departments in absence of supervisor
Performs other duties as assigned
Qualifications Required:
High school diploma or equivalent
Must be a certified welder and be able to pass ASME welding test
Must have or be able to attain certificate in advanced robotic programming within first 12-18 months within role
10+ years of welding/fitting experience in a heavy steel fabrication environment
5+ years of experience with operating or programming welding robots
Ability to use Microsoft Office (Outlook, Teams, Word)
Demonstrated ability to lead a team in a heavy manufacturing environment
Capability to mentor and train others and to share knowledge
Familiar with heavy steel fabrication techniques, including manual and CNC fabrication equipment
Advanced proficiency in reading, interpreting and explaining welding procedures
Ability to troubleshoot welding parameter issues
Ability to interpret engineering documentation
Able to keep team members well informed and to draw on other's expertise when required
Ability to professionally communicate and work cooperatively with others
Ability to manage time effectively to meet strict time deadlines and production volumes
Judgment to comply with instructions, prescribed routines, methods, and practices
Attention to detail and ability to handle multiple priorities
Willingness to learn and to train others
Preferred:
Up to 2 years of formal post-high school specialized trade, technical school or college
